Unveiling the Secrets of Purple and Red: The Perfect Color Palette for Your Home

The vibrant energy of red. The regal mystery of purple. Combining these two seemingly disparate colors might seem daring, but when done right, a purple and red color palette can create a truly stunning and unforgettable home interior. This article unveils the secrets to successfully integrating these powerful hues, transforming your space from ordinary to extraordinary.

Understanding the Psychology of Purple and Red

Before diving into design specifics, let's explore the psychological impact of these colors. Red is often associated with passion, energy, excitement, and warmth. It's a bold color that commands attention. Purple, on the other hand, evokes feelings of luxury, royalty, creativity, and mystery. It's a sophisticated color that adds depth and intrigue.

The key to successfully combining them lies in understanding their strengths and carefully balancing their intensity. Too much red can feel overwhelming, while too much purple can appear somber. The trick is to find the perfect harmony.

Red's Varied Shades & Their Impact

Red isn't a one-size-fits-all color. Consider these shades and their effects:

  • Crimson: Rich and sophisticated, crimson adds a touch of elegance.
  • Scarlet: Bold and vibrant, scarlet exudes energy and passion.
  • Burgundy: Deep and luxurious, burgundy adds a touch of old-world charm.
  • Coral: Softer and more approachable, coral brings a lighter, more playful energy.

Exploring the Nuances of Purple

Similarly, the spectrum of purple offers a variety of moods:

  • Lavender: Light and airy, lavender promotes relaxation and tranquility.
  • Violet: Rich and deep, violet adds a touch of royalty and sophistication.
  • Amethyst: Subtle and calming, amethyst creates a sense of peacefulness.
  • Plum: Dark and dramatic, plum adds a touch of mystery and intrigue.

Creating a Harmonious Purple and Red Interior

Now, let's explore ways to successfully incorporate this powerful color combination:

1. The Accent Approach:

Start subtly. Use one color as a dominant shade (perhaps purple on the walls) and the other as an accent (red throw pillows, artwork, or rugs). This creates a balanced look without being overwhelming. Think lavender walls with scarlet cushions, or amethyst bedding accented with burgundy pillows.

2. The Complementary Contrast:

Red and purple sit opposite each other on the color wheel, making them naturally complementary. This allows for a bold and striking design. Use this approach in rooms where you want to create a dramatic statement. Consider a deep red accent wall against a rich purple backdrop, or vice-versa.

3. Introducing Neutrals:

Neutral colors like beige, cream, gray, or white are essential for balancing the intensity of red and purple. They act as a calming buffer, preventing the space from feeling too saturated. Incorporate these shades in your flooring, larger furniture pieces, or trim. A gray sofa against a plum wall with red accessories, for example, creates a sophisticated and balanced look.

4. Playing with Textures:

Varying textures can add depth and visual interest to your space. Combine smooth surfaces with rougher ones, and shiny materials with matte ones. This helps to soften the impact of the bold colors and prevent a monotonous look.

5. Lighting is Key:

Proper lighting can dramatically affect the perception of color. Experiment with different lighting options to find the perfect ambiance. Warm lighting can enhance the richness of the colors, while cooler lighting can create a more modern feel.

Rooms to Consider

This vibrant palette can work in various rooms, but some are particularly well-suited:

  • Living Room: Create a dramatic and inviting space with a balance of purple and red.
  • Dining Room: Stimulate conversation and create a lively atmosphere.
  • Bedroom (sparingly): Use softer shades of purple and red for a touch of romance and sophistication, but avoid overwhelming the space.
